Jim Burns’ first makes an attempt at pictures have been footage of icicles hanging from the bushes within the Midwest the place he grew up.
“I’ve always been a very visual person,” the Scottsdale resident stated.
“I inherited my love of nature from my parents, and as a young adult spent a lot of time poring over coffee table books by Art Wolfe, David Muench and Ansel Adams.”
But he discovered wildlife extra fascinating than icicles, and one in every of his images seems within the Arizona Game and Fish Department’s 2026 calendar.
First there have been birds, and he needed to doc the species he was seeing.
“From there I evolved from portraiture to flight and action because I wanted to share a deeper dive into lifestyle and natural history, aspects of nature that casual birders often overlook or miss.”
He’s been doing so for 40 years on and off whereas elevating a household and pursuing a profession in a special discipline.
“My technique has changed over time, from running around trying to shoot as many things as I could to slowing down and spending much more time observing how animals survive and interact with their environment and other species,” he stated.
“I’m always looking now for things that surprise and amaze me, things I haven’t seen before or know casual nature lovers rarely get to observe.”
That connection to nature has led him to some conclusions.
“This planet is in trouble. We all have to be proactive and do every little thing we can to turn the tide.”
